public void deleteAllMessages() { IOHelper.deleteChildren(getDirectory()); }
@Override public void start() throws Exception { if (started.compareAndSet(false, true)) { journal = new Journal() { @Override public void cleanup() { super.cleanup(); txStoreCleanup(); } }; journal.setDirectory(getDirectory()); journal.setMaxFileLength(journalMaxFileLength); journal.setWriteBatchSize(journalWriteBatchSize); IOHelper.mkdirs(journal.getDirectory()); journal.start(); recoverPendingLocalTransactions(); store(new KahaTraceCommand().setMessage("LOADED " + new Date())); } }
public void deleteAllMessages() { IOHelper.deleteChildren(getDirectory()); }
public void deleteAllMessages() { IOHelper.deleteChildren(getDirectory()); }
public void deleteAllMessages() { IOHelper.deleteChildren(getDirectory()); }
@Override public void start() throws Exception { if (started.compareAndSet(false, true)) { journal = new Journal() { @Override public void cleanup() { super.cleanup(); txStoreCleanup(); } }; journal.setDirectory(getDirectory()); journal.setMaxFileLength(journalMaxFileLength); journal.setWriteBatchSize(journalWriteBatchSize); IOHelper.mkdirs(journal.getDirectory()); journal.start(); recoverPendingLocalTransactions(); store(new KahaTraceCommand().setMessage("LOADED " + new Date())); } }
@Override public void start() throws Exception { if (started.compareAndSet(false, true)) { journal = new Journal() { @Override public void cleanup() { super.cleanup(); txStoreCleanup(); } }; journal.setDirectory(getDirectory()); journal.setMaxFileLength(journalMaxFileLength); journal.setWriteBatchSize(journalWriteBatchSize); IOHelper.mkdirs(journal.getDirectory()); journal.start(); recoverPendingLocalTransactions(); store(new KahaTraceCommand().setMessage("LOADED " + new Date())); } }
@Override public void start() throws Exception { if (started.compareAndSet(false, true)) { journal = new Journal() { @Override public void cleanup() { super.cleanup(); txStoreCleanup(); } }; journal.setDirectory(getDirectory()); journal.setMaxFileLength(journalMaxFileLength); journal.setWriteBatchSize(journalWriteBatchSize); IOHelper.mkdirs(journal.getDirectory()); journal.start(); recoverPendingLocalTransactions(); store(new KahaTraceCommand().setMessage("LOADED " + new Date())); } }